Our School Psychology PhD program equips you for a rewarding professional journey in this dynamic field. Start with just a bachelor's degree and complete your doctorate in approximately five years of full-time coursework.
Pursue roles as a chief school psychologist within educational systems. Progress to leadership roles in school psychology or student support services. Join academia as an instructor in school psychology programs.
Based in Western Pennsylvania, our integrated curriculum allows you to efficiently obtain:
an MEd in Educational Psychology,
followed by a PhD in School Psychology.
We review applications continuously, with priority given to submissions received before January 15 for the subsequent fall term.
This program prepares you for the shifting research landscape and transforming responsibilities of school psychologists across Pennsylvania and nationwide. Throughout your studies, you'll access numerous professional advantages:
Gain credentials for school psychology positions, with projected 19% job growth by 2024 (US Bureau of Labor Statistics).
Meet state-specific educational mandates that increasingly demand doctoral qualifications for school psychologists.
Progress to administrative leadership roles or train future school psychology professionals.
